What is an entry level 35 dollars an hour job?

'Entry Level 35 Dollars An Hour' jobs are positions that require little to no prior experience and pay $35 per hour. These roles can be found across various industries, such as healthcare, information technology, skilled trades, and customer service. The high hourly wage for entry-level jobs is often due to strong demand for certain skills, labor shortages, or specialized training requirements. Examples include entry-level web developers, medical assistants, and certain trade apprenticeships. These roles can offer a great starting point for career growth and financial stability.

What types of entry level roles typically offer a starting wage of $35 an hour, and what should applicants expect regarding team structure and support?

Entry-level positions that offer $35 per hour are often found in specialized industries such as healthcare, technology, engineering, or skilled trades. In these roles, new hires can expect to work in structured teams with experienced colleagues who provide training and mentorship. Collaboration is common, especially during onboarding, to help employees acclimate to company processes and tools. Supportive work environments are typical, with supervisors and peers available to answer questions and ensure a smooth transition into the role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in an entry level position paying $35 an hour, and why are they important?

To excel in an entry-level position at this pay rate, candidates typically need a relevant associate or bachelor's degree, foundational knowledge in the field, and strong problem-solving abilities. Familiarity with industry-standard tools, software, or systemsβ€”such as Microsoft Office, CRM platforms, or technical equipmentβ€”may be required, depending on the specific job. Exceptional communication, teamwork, and a proactive work ethic are valuable soft skills that make candidates stand out. These competencies ensure efficient job performance, adaptability, and the ability to contribute value from the start in a competitive, well-compensated role.
